Mine came in today, the feel so far is amazing. So glad I can rate the encoders with a fingertips push/pull rather than gripping and turning the wrist, it’s opened up a lot of additional usability. I wish they were slight smaller diameter wise, but I can still fit my finger between them.

Does anyone know if the chroma caps fit nice on the volume knob?

They fit, but you have to order the 270° knob for the volume knob. I got the super knob and while it fit, I kind of wish they made a smaller one.
